Espionage expert and consummate professional, Natalya is one of those people who are remarkably difficult to read. She’s polite, calm, a little bit witty, and overall gives off the impression that she spends her time contemplating new ways to kill a man with a butter knife. At only thirty-six she’s fairly young for a master wherhandler and Huntleader, more so given that she’s a woman in a position often dominated by men. It’s no secret around High Reaches that she’s also a veteran of the ill-fated Battle of Hestings… where she lost her first wher. At only five foot three she’s dwarfed by Natask, who is an enormous ugly monster of a wher; the gold is the heavy artillery to Natalya’s precision strikes, and the two of them together make a remarkably well-coordinated team.

Phantom Hunt is a tight-knit group of handlers specially trained to back up the Third Wings on assignments. One mission they might be tracking a murder suspect for Third-One, the next they might be running an extraction for a Third-Two rider in deep cover. In modern terms, they might be considered a special ops division. All handlers are expected to be flexible and willing to take initiative as situations arise. In return, Natalya doesn’t micromanage, preferring to observe and guide with a light hand and let her hunt do their jobs unimpeded.

All Phantom handlers are all trained in a certain basic skill set, including combat in dense cover and tight spaces, concealment, tracking, and field survival. Natalya believes that versatility is the key to victory, however, and is almost always willing to accommodate new talent. Her current squire, for instance, is an archer who’s taken up a role as lookout and sniper for the hunt. Those seeking to join or squire with Phantom Hunt will consult with Natalya personally to find a role that suits their skill set, whether that’s close combat or field medicine. Big egos beware: this is not a group where arrogance and showboating will survive for long.
